好文档就是一把金锄头!
欢迎来到金锄头文库![会员中心]
电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

面向物联网的嵌入式服务发现机制研究-剖析洞察.pptx

25页
  • 卖家[上传人]:永***
  • 文档编号:596793508
  • 上传时间:2025-01-14
  • 文档格式:PPTX
  • 文档大小:135.05KB
  • / 25 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 面向物联网的嵌入式服务发现机制研究,物联网概述 服务发现机制重要性 嵌入式系统特点 物联网中嵌入式服务发现需求 现有技术分析 研究目标与方法 设计原则与架构 实验验证与展望,Contents Page,目录页,物联网概述,面向物联网的嵌入式服务发现机制研究,物联网概述,物联网的定义与特征,1.物联网是互联网的一种延伸和应用拓展,通过各种传感器、智能设备等连接起来,实现物与物之间的信息交换和通信2.物联网具有感知、识别、通讯、决策、执行等功能,可以实现对物理世界的智能化管理和控制3.物联网技术的核心在于数据的采集、传输和处理,通过大数据分析、云计算等技术手段,实现对海量数据的高效处理和利用物联网的关键技术,1.无线通信技术:包括蓝牙、Wi-Fi、ZigBee、LoRa等,用于实现设备间的无线数据传输2.传感器技术:用于感知环境参数,如温度、湿度、光照等,为物联网提供实时数据支持3.数据处理与存储技术:采用大数据处理框架(如Hadoop、Spark)进行数据存储和分析,提高数据处理效率4.安全技术:确保物联网设备和数据的安全,包括加密算法、身份认证、访问控制等物联网概述,物联网的应用范围,1.智能家居:通过物联网技术,实现家居设备的远程控制、自动化管理,提高生活便利性。

      2.智慧城市:通过物联网技术,收集城市运行的各种数据,实现城市管理的智能化、精细化3.工业自动化:通过物联网技术,实现生产设备的远程监控、故障诊断和维护,提高生产效率4.医疗健康:通过物联网技术,实现医疗设备的远程监测、健康管理和医疗服务的优化5.农业信息化:通过物联网技术,实现农业生产的精准化管理、病虫害预警和资源优化配置6.交通运输:通过物联网技术,实现交通设施的智能化管理、车辆定位和调度优化物联网面临的挑战,1.安全问题:随着物联网设备的普及,如何保证数据传输的安全性成为一个重要问题2.数据隐私:如何在保护个人隐私的前提下,合理利用物联网产生的大量数据3.标准化和互操作性:不同厂商的设备和平台之间的兼容性问题,需要制定统一的标准和协议4.能耗问题:物联网设备通常需要持续工作,如何降低能耗、延长设备寿命是一个挑战5.法律法规:随着物联网技术的发展,相关的法律法规也需要不断完善,以适应新的技术应用服务发现机制重要性,面向物联网的嵌入式服务发现机制研究,服务发现机制重要性,物联网中的服务发现机制,1.促进资源优化配置:服务发现机制能够确保设备和应用程序之间的有效通信,从而更高效地利用网络资源。

      2.提高系统可靠性:通过自动发现服务,减少了因手动配置或更新而导致的故障,增强了整个网络的稳定性3.支持动态服务管理:随着物联网设备的增加和服务需求的变化,服务发现机制能够适应这些变化,提供灵活的服务管理4.增强用户体验:准确的服务发现可以确保用户能够快速找到所需的服务,提升用户体验5.促进创新与开发:服务发现机制为开发者提供了一种有效的工具,帮助他们快速构建和维护适用于多种应用场景的应用程序6.支持跨平台协同工作:在物联网环境中,不同设备和服务之间需要良好的协作,服务发现机制有助于实现这种跨平台的无缝连接嵌入式系统特点,面向物联网的嵌入式服务发现机制研究,嵌入式系统特点,实时性与低功耗,1.嵌入式系统通常需要在有限的资源下实现快速响应和高效处理,因此具有很高的实时性要求2.同时,为了延长设备的电池寿命,嵌入式设备往往需要采用低功耗设计,这包括优化处理器的运行频率、使用节能硬件组件等技术手段3.为了满足这些性能指标,嵌入式系统的设计必须考虑到软硬件协同工作的效率,以及如何在保证功能完整性的同时减少不必要的计算和数据传输安全性与可靠性,1.嵌入式系统常常部署在网络连接的边缘,面临来自外部环境的安全威胁,如恶意软件攻击、未授权访问等。

      2.为了保护数据安全和系统稳定运行,嵌入式服务发现机制需要具备高度的安全性,包括加密通信、访问控制、安全审计等安全措施3.同时,由于嵌入式系统的复杂性和多样性,确保其高可靠性是设计过程中的关键挑战,涉及硬件冗余、故障检测与恢复机制、持续监控等方面嵌入式系统特点,可扩展性与模块化,1.随着物联网应用的不断丰富和发展,设备数量和种类日益增加,这就要求嵌入式服务发现机制必须具备良好的可扩展性,以便支持新的设备类型和服务需求2.模块化设计是提高嵌入式系统可扩展性的有效方法,通过将系统划分为独立的模块进行管理和升级,可以方便地应对不同场景下的需求变化3.同时,模块化也有助于降低系统的维护难度,因为每个模块都可以独立开发、测试和更新,而不影响整个系统的运行兼容性与标准化,1.嵌入式服务发现机制需要能够与现有的多种技术和标准兼容,以便于与其他设备或平台进行互操作2.标准化是提高嵌入式系统兼容性和通用性的重要途径,通过遵循统一的接口规范和协议标准,可以实现不同设备和服务之间的无缝对接3.同时,标准化也有助于简化系统设计和开发过程,降低开发成本,并促进技术的快速迭代和应用推广嵌入式系统特点,1.嵌入式服务发现机制应当关注用户的操作体验和交互便捷性,提供直观易懂的用户界面和流畅的操作流程。

      2.随着物联网应用场景的多样化,用户对服务的个性化和定制化需求日益增长,嵌入式服务发现机制需要能够灵活适应不同的用户需求,提供定制化的服务推荐和配置选项3.同时,良好的交互性也意味着系统能够及时响应用户的指令和反馈,通过智能化的方式提供帮助和支持,增强用户的满意度和忠诚度用户体验与交互性,物联网中嵌入式服务发现需求,面向物联网的嵌入式服务发现机制研究,物联网中嵌入式服务发现需求,物联网中嵌入式服务发现的需求,1.实时性与准确性,-需求分析:在物联网环境中,设备和服务的更新迭代速度极快,因此嵌入式服务发现机制需要能够实时地识别新出现的服务,并确保其准确性技术实现:通过采用轻量级的消息传递协议和高效的数据结构设计,可以保证服务的快速发现和准确匹配2.可扩展性和兼容性,-需求分析:随着物联网设备的增加,服务发现机制需要具备良好的可扩展性,以支持大量设备的接入和管理技术实现:通过模块化设计和微服务架构,可以灵活地添加新的服务发现组件,同时保持系统的整体兼容性3.安全性与隐私保护,-需求分析:在物联网环境中,服务发现涉及到大量的数据传输和处理,必须确保数据的机密性、完整性和可用性技术实现:采用加密通信协议、访问控制技术和数据脱敏技术,可以有效防止数据泄露和非法访问。

      4.跨平台兼容性,-需求分析:物联网设备可能运行在不同的操作系统和硬件平台上,因此服务发现机制需要支持跨平台的兼容性技术实现:通过标准化接口设计和跨平台的数据交换协议,可以实现不同设备和服务之间的无缝连接5.低功耗优化,-需求分析:物联网设备通常需要在电池供电的情况下工作较长时间,因此嵌入式服务发现机制需要具备低功耗的特性技术实现:通过优化算法和资源调度策略,可以减少不必要的数据传输和计算消耗,延长设备的使用寿命6.智能化服务管理,-需求分析:为了提高服务质量和管理效率,物联网中的嵌入式服务发现机制需要具备一定程度的智能化技术实现:通过引入机器学习和人工智能技术,可以自动学习用户行为和设备状态,提供个性化的服务推荐和优化建议现有技术分析,面向物联网的嵌入式服务发现机制研究,现有技术分析,1.云平台服务发现机制通常采用RESTful API、WebSocket、MQTT等技术实现,这些技术使得服务提供者和服务请求者能够高效地在云端进行交互2.通过服务注册与发现(Service Registry and Discovery),云平台可以管理服务的生命周期,包括服务的创建、更新、删除和查询等操作。

      3.服务发现机制的实现依赖于智能路由算法,如DHT(Distributed Hash Table)、Paxos等,这些算法确保了服务的快速定位和负载均衡微服务架构中的服务发现,1.在微服务架构中,服务发现是确保不同服务组件间正确通信的关键这通常通过服务注册中心(如Eureka)来实现,该中心负责维护一个服务注册表,服务提供者和消费者可以据此找到对方2.为了提高服务的可用性和容错性,微服务架构支持服务之间的动态发现和调用,例如使用观察者模式或事件总线来处理服务的生命周期变化和调用通知3.服务发现机制需要考虑到安全性和隐私保护,例如通过加密通信、访问控制列表等方式来防止服务被未授权访问或数据泄露基于云计算的服务发现机制,现有技术分析,物联网设备间的服务发现,1.物联网设备通常部署在资源受限的环境中,因此,服务发现机制需要优化以适应低功耗、低带宽和有限的计算能力2.物联网设备的服务发现通常采用轻量级协议,如轻量级HTTP/2或MQTT,这些协议减少了数据传输的开销,并简化了设备的网络配置过程3.为了提高服务的可靠性和连续性,物联网设备通常会采用心跳机制或定期轮询的方式来监测服务的可达性,确保服务的持续运行。

      边缘计算中的服务发现,1.边缘计算旨在将数据处理和存储任务从云端转移到网络的边缘,减少延迟和带宽消耗在这一过程中,服务发现机制需要支持跨多个网络层次的发现,确保服务的无缝接入2.边缘计算中的服务发现机制可能包括本地缓存、代理服务器或直接与边缘设备通信的方式,以减少对中心化服务的依赖,提高响应速度3.为了适应边缘计算的资源限制,服务发现机制可能需要实现轻量化的数据包传输和高效的缓存策略,以减少数据传输的开销和提高服务的可用性研究目标与方法,面向物联网的嵌入式服务发现机制研究,研究目标与方法,物联网的嵌入式服务发现机制,1.服务发现机制的重要性:在物联网环境中,确保设备和服务的有效通信与协同工作是至关重要的一个有效的服务发现机制可以简化设备的网络配置,减少维护成本,并提高整体系统的性能和可靠性2.面向物联网的服务发现机制需求分析:随着物联网设备数量的激增和应用场景的多样化,传统的服务发现机制已无法满足日益增长的需求因此,研究需要针对物联网特定的需求进行设计,包括低功耗、高可靠性、快速响应等特点3.技术架构的创新:为了适应物联网的动态性和多样性,服务发现机制的技术架构需要进行创新这可能涉及使用轻量级的消息传递协议、分布式数据存储结构以及自适应的网络拓扑管理等技术,以实现高效的服务发现和负载均衡。

      4.安全性考虑:在设计面向物联网的嵌入式服务发现机制时,必须考虑到安全性问题这包括数据加密、访问控制、认证机制以及防止服务拒绝攻击(DoS)和中间人攻击等通过采用先进的安全技术和策略,可以确保服务的可用性和数据的完整性5.可扩展性与容错性:由于物联网设备可能会分布在不同的地理位置,且网络环境多变,服务发现机制需要具备良好的可扩展性和容错性这意味着机制应该能够支持大规模的设备接入,同时在遇到网络故障或设备失效时仍能保持正常运行6.未来趋势与前沿技术的应用:随着人工智能、机器学习和边缘计算等前沿技术的发展,未来的服务发现机制可能会更加智能化和自动化例如,利用深度学习算法优化服务匹配过程,或者在边缘设备上部署智能决策支持系统以提高服务发现的效率和准确性设计原则与架构,面向物联网的嵌入式服务发现机制研究,设计原则与架构,设计原则与架构,1.可扩展性:面向物联网的嵌入式服务发现机制应具备良好的可扩展性,能够灵活适应不同规模和类型的物联网设备和服务设计时应考虑未来技术发展趋势,预留足够的空间以支持新技术的集成和应用2.高效性:在保证服务质量的前提下,应尽量减少服务发现过程中的时间开销和资源消耗通过优化算法和数据结构,实现高效的信息检索和匹配,确保服务发现过程快速、准确地完成。

      3.安全性:在设计面向物联网的嵌入式服务发现机制时,必须高度重视安全性问题要采取有效措施保护服务的隐私性和完整性,防止未经授权的访问和服务劫持,确保物联网系统的安全运行4.可靠性:服务发现机。

      点击阅读更多内容
      关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
      手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
      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.